Cabinet Reshuffle
January 2008 | Risk SummaryPresident Hugo Chávez has reshuffled his cabinet in January after his defeat in the December constitutional referendum. The most high-profile decision has been to replace Vice President Jorge Rodriguez, whose chief role was to oversee the more radical political agenda in 2007, with less controversial Infrastructure Minister Ramon Carrizales.
